Rhode Island to Texas Car Shipping (2024 Cost Guide)

Quick answer: The average cost to ship a car 1,937 miles from Rhode Island to Texas ranges from $1,592 to $2,251 and takes 3–11 days depending on factors like the transport type and season. For a more detailed quote, use our car shipping cost calculator.

Shipping an SUV or truck from Rhode Island to Texas

Since vehicles like SUV, trucks, and vans are larger and heavier, it’s a bit more expensive to ship them than a sedan. How much more?

If you’re shipping a larger vehicle from Rhode Island to Texas you should expect to pay between $1,990 and $2,814.

Factors that affect the price of shipping a car from Rhode Island to Texas

When transporting your vehicle from the Ocean State to the Lone Star State, these factors will influence your final price:

  • Type of transport: Options like open, enclosed, or top-loaded transport cater to different needs. Open carriers are cost-effective, while enclosed transport provides added protection for luxury or classic cars. If you’re not sure, check out our guide comparing open vs. enclosed car shipping.
  • Vehicle size and type: The dimensions and weight of your vehicle directly affect shipping costs. The larger and heavier your vehicle, the more it will cost to ship your car to Texas.
  • Distance and route: The journey from Rhode Island to Texas spans approximately 1,937 miles, influencing fuel and labor costs. The longer the distance, the bigger the price tag.
  • Time of the year: Seasonal demand impacts the price of getting your car out of Rhode Island, with summer and winter holidays often seeing a spike due to increased moving and travel activity.
  • Fuel prices: Fluctuating fuel prices can significantly affect transport costs. This is an important consideration given the distance between Rhode Island and Texas and the varying gas prices across the country.
  • Delivery expectations: Because it’ll make their job easier, your auto shipper may give you a pricing discount if you’re flexible on delivery dates. That being said, getting your car from Rhode Island to Texas should take between 3 and 11 days. Expedited services are available but come at a higher cost.

What else should you know about shipping a car from Rhode Island to Texas?

  • Car insurance requirements: Every driver in Texas is mandated to have liability insurance known as 30/60/25 coverage. However, this minimum requirement may fall short in adequately covering the aftermath of a moderately severe accident. The basic policy offers $30,000 for individual injury coverage, up to $60,000 for injury coverage per accident, and provides up to $25,000 for property damage.
  • Vehicle inspection: In Texas, vehicles undergo annual safety inspections covering brakes, lights, steering, tires, etc. Some qualify for a two-year cycle.
  • Driver’s license: New residents are required to obtain a Texas driver license from the Texas Department of Public Safety within 90 days of moving to the state.
  • Additional taxes: New residents must pay a $90 new resident tax instead of a use tax for a vehicle they bring into Texas. This applies if the vehicle was previously registered in the new resident's name in another state or foreign country.

FAQ

Does someone have to be present when picking up my car in Rhode Island and when dropping off my car in Texas?

Most companies will require someone that is at least 18 years old to be present when picking up your car in Rhode Island and when dropping it off in Texas.

Do you need car insurance when shipping your car from Rhode Island to Texas?

If you’re not driving the vehicle from Rhode Island to Texas, you aren't required to have typical car insurance. Your car hauler should have adequate insurance if an accident happened on the drive to Texas, which you should verify before loading your car in Rhode Island.

If you’re driving your car at all in either state, you should understand the requirements. When relocating to Rhode Island, it's essential to secure car insurance meeting the state's minimum requirements, which include liability coverage of $25,000 per person for bodily injury, $50,000 total for bodily injury per accident, and $25,000 for property damage per accident. Additionally, Rhode Island mandates all drivers to carry uninsured motorist coverage for comprehensive protection.

How long does it take to ship a car from Rhode Island to Texas?

Car shipping companies can travel about 500 miles per day. The trip from Rhode Island to Texas is about 1937 miles, and that’s as fast as about 4 days. However, most car transport companies will take 3-11 days to travel from Rhode Island to Texas.

Will I be required to have a vehicle inspection in either state?

All newly registered vehicles (except new vehicles) must pass a Safety and Emissions inspection or have a valid inspection certificate within 5 days of registration. If not, the registration may be suspended. New vehicles are exempt from inspection for 2 years or until they reach 24,000 miles. Different categories of vehicles have different inspection requirements and must be inspected at a licensed station.

In Texas, vehicles undergo annual safety inspections covering brakes, lights, steering, tires, etc. Some qualify for a two-year cycle.

If I have a driver’s license in Rhode Island, will I need one in Texas?

New residents are required to obtain a Texas driver license from the Texas Department of Public Safety within 90 days of moving to the state.

If I bought a car in Rhode Island, will I be required to pay sales tax in Texas after shipping it there?

It’s important to understand any tax implications if you’re having a car shipped from Rhode Island to Texas after purchasing it.

New residents must pay a $90 new resident tax instead of a use tax for a vehicle they bring into Texas. This applies if the vehicle was previously registered in the new resident's name in another state or foreign country.

We recommend that you always check for updated tax information in both Rhode Island and Texas to avoid any hidden costs.
